Moving to a new computer and my Illustrator Library files are lost.

Yesterday I installed Illustrator and Creative Cloud on a new PC to replace my old desktop.  When I openned Illustrator and logged in, my history and Library files where present.  At one point I had to delete the old computer from my list of machines that have access to my account [a limit of two].  I do not know if this is related but at some point, I lost all my history and Library files.  Can anyone tell me what might have happened and if this is recoverable?

Are these Libraries saved to the cloud or as AI files? If they are stored on your computer, you need to move them to the new computer. Go to Edit > My settings > Export
